How much money do you need per day in Lanzarote? You should plan to spend around €161 ($170) per day on your vacation in Lanzarote, which is the average daily price based on the expenses of other visitors. Past travelers have spent, on average, €42 ($45) on meals for one day and €40 ($42) on local transportation.

How much is 200 cigarettes in Lanzarote?

Tobacco is very cheap in Lanzarote compared to nearly everywhere else in Western Europe: a carton of 200 Marlboro cigarettes typically costs about €35.


Is Lanzarote cheap or expensive?

Lanzarote's Cost of Living versus Mainland Spain On average rent prices are 23% less than in mainland Spain. Generally Lanzarote's consumer prices are 21% lower than Spain. Prices in Lanzarote restaurants are 27% lower than mainland Spain. Prices in Lanzarote's supermarkets are generally 14% lower than Spain.

Do I need cash for Lanzarote?

ATMs and credit cards: ATMs can be spotted throughout Lanzarote, and they generally accept all major European and North American credit cards. Puerto Calero seems to be a little less endowed in this respect, so tourists should be aware of this aspect and raise cash before heading for Puerto Calero.


Is it customary to tip in Lanzarote?

Tipping. It's customary to leave a tip of around 5% to 15% of your bill's total at restaurants ashore in Lanzarote. Very few establishments will include a service charge in the final bill, but if this has been accounted for additional tipping is not expected.


Which is the warmest side of Lanzarote?

And if you wonder which is the warmest side of Lanzarote, the answer is always south. Head to the southern part of the island for warmer weather as coasts are sheltered from the winds. Contrarily, the northern part of Lanzarote is usually a bit colder and cloudier due to the trade winds.

Is there a posh part of Lanzarote?

Puerto Calero - This marina town is known for its luxury yachts, designer stores, and upscale restaurants. This area would have the greatest concentration of super high-end homes and has a very private community feel to it.


How much is a 3 course meal in Lanzarote?

How much does a restaurant meal cost in Lanzarote? A three course meal with fillet steaks and a decent bottle of wine for two in a Spanish seaside restaurant typically costs around €85 (main courses typically cost between €10 and €20). The same meal for two with fresh fish would cost about €75.
